In case of an emergency, how can I contact a chaperone while my child is at Kelly Canyon?
// iSkiRexburg // Uncategorized No Responses
We have little to no cell service on the mountain so you will be unable to reach us on our cell phones while we are skiing. In case of an emergency we will contact you using a land line at Kelly Canyon. If you need to contact us you can call the Kelly Canyon ticket office at (208) 538 – 6251. They usually close by 8:00 pm.

Will My Child Ski Alone?
// iSkiRexburg // Uncategorized No Responses
A: If your child is a new skier/snowboarder, it is ALWAYS best that they plan to ski with a friend or two. Their lessons will only take one hour and then the rest of the evening they will be free to ski/board on their own. Please advise your children that if they are unfamiliar with the hill, they should stay on Skier’s Lane (lift #3) or the bunny hill for their first couple of trips. If they are unsure of what lift to ride, they can always ask an iSki Chaperone (will be wearing red armbands) a Kelly Canyon employee, or a member of the Ski Patrol (wearing red and black coats).
